I finally watched Rebels (extended essential episodes list) so I could be up to speed to catch the first couple episodes of Ahsoka. I’m digging it and glad I watched Rebels before as this very much feels like Rebels S5.
I gotta say, the people that can’t get past Rebels and especially TCW being animated are seriously missing out on some of the best SW content in existence.
There’s no question imo, Ahsoka IS the best female in SW. More than that, she’s one of the most compelling characters of all due to her role and arc. I’d go so far as to say that save for an extremely select few (Yoda, Windu, Kenobi, Anakin, Luke) she’s probably the next greatest Jedi of the era. In some ways, she exemplifies what it means to be one and is even MORE Jedi following her exile than these 5 were during TCW.
Sabine and Hera are also well developed characters that are among the best females in SW. It’s amusing how Ahsoka views Sabine as this stubborn pupil. It’s like looking into a mirror of Ahsoka herself as a padawan, when Anakin thought the same of her.
For those unfamiliar and complaining about lack of strong males, Ezra and Thrawn are coming. The latter is one of the very best villains in the entire SW canon.
